## Tuning: Cache Invalidation

Cartouche's catalog cache invalidates on write events, with a periodic sweep as a backstop for missed events. Reviewers should verify that any change keeps the sweep interval strictly shorter than the stale-read SLA, and that fanout batch sizes don't overwhelm the bus during bulk imports. The current constants, chosen from the Q3 load tests, are:

constants for hahof-bajep:
THRESHOLDS = {
    "sorwyn": 797,
    "jorath": 933,
    "pramir": 998,
    "wenath": 950,
    "silok": 489,
    "prawyn": 572,
    "praiel": 821,
}

**CI note: timezone weirdness in report exports**

Heads up, support folks — if a customer says their Ledgerpine export shows times shifted by a few hours, it's probably the CI image. The export workers got rebuilt last week and the base image defaults to UTC, while older workers used the account's locale. Fix is rolling out; meanwhile tell customers the data itself is fine, just the display offset. Affected exports carry the build token shown below.

build token for bajof-tahop: htk4_a981

## Handover Note: Next Year's Headcount

To the sales leads, from the outgoing director at Brindlehart Co. The plan adds six account executives in the first half, weighted toward the Velsin territory, plus two sales engineers in Q3. Backfill approvals stay with regional managers; net-new roles require my successor's sign-off. Ramp assumptions are conservative at five months. The staffing logic connects to the plan noted below.

management briefing: The northern region missed its Jorael quota by 14.5 percent last quarter. Nordorax Logistics plans to lower the Casdor list price by 61.4 percent in July. The board signed off on a budget of $219.8 million for Project Tamax. The renewal with Briielax Foods closes at $51.2 million a year, 65.4 percent above the last contract.

## Gridwright: fill engine notes

Gridwright generates themed crosswords via backtracking fill over a scored wordlist. The solver abandons a branch when projected fill quality drops below threshold; this keeps latency predictable at the cost of occasional retries. Don't touch the scoring weights without rerunning the Pemberly benchmark suite. The constants below control branch pruning, retry budgets, and minimum word scores.

constants for tahof-kafop:
CAPS = {
    "siliel": 406,
    "silael": 168,
    "rusath": 492,
    "noveth": 652,
    "ulaion": 1020,
}